Image of ebay item 1965 TOPPS FOOTBALL EMPTY 5 cent DISPLAY BOX (VG) - RARE/TOUGH This might be the first 1965 Topps display box I've seen. Interestingly, the player on the cover appears to be a New York Giant, but Topps produced only AFL cards in 1965.

Image of ebay item 1976 Crane Franco Harris Football Disc Ultra Rare From Bag Only Pop 1 on Ebay 1976 Crane Discs are plentiful, except for this extremely short-printed one. According to Beckett, the other discs could be obtained as a set via mail, but Harris was distributed only in potato chip bags.

Image of ebay item Original 1955 Baltimore Colts Team 8 X 10 Photo This image appears on the 1956 Topps Colts team card. (Topps used 1955 team photos on all of its 1956 team cards.) Leroy Vaughn, father of baseball's Mo Vaughn, is #46 in the back row.
Image of ebay item 1957-58 Swedish Sport 420-Series #147 Milt Campbell USA (Cleveland Browns) Campbell took silver in the decathlon in the 1952 Olympics and gold in 1956. He played for the Cleveland Browns in 1957, and in the CFL for several years after that. If you squint, you can see him on the 1958 Topps Browns team card. He's number 48, next to Jim Brown in the second row.
